The NOW Orchestra was founded in 1987 by saxophonist and co-director Coat Cooke. The fifteen piece improvising ensemble is based out of the West Coast of North America, with members hailing from Washington and Vancouver. As of the late '90s, the line-up included co-director and guitarist <a href="spotify:artist:1iXnT1UGi7RhnqWNJ09Fno">Ron Samworth</a>, cellist <a href="spotify:artist:602DnpaSXJB4b9DZrvxbDc">Peggy Lee</a>, drummer <a href="spotify:artist:4auQ6V5XgmMW4WqepjqYpH">Dylan VanDerSchyff</a>, and pianist <a href="spotify:artist:0gpBLj8scpUxYjDWMJok7L">Paul Plimley</a>. NOW Orchestra has performed at festivals including Vancouver's du Maurier International Jazz Festival and FIMAV, and has collaborated with major improvisers such as <a href="spotify:artist:1eE9oB7Z69NzfALiUJYKUm">Wadada Leo Smith</a>, <a href="spotify:artist:0w4mLSXg39n1UuyK7eNLTD">Marilyn Crispell</a>, Lawrence "Butch" Morris, <a href="spotify:artist:4CFxdIh8rpqMy5fDOzEd0s">Vinny Golia</a> and <a href="spotify:artist:0MofP0aHBkL1FXSqM2huGD">Rene Lussier</a>. ~ Joslyn Layne, Rovi
